* Mathieu Desnoyers via Libc-alpha:
Changes since v14:
- Update copyright range to include 2020.
- Introduce __ASSUME_RSEQ defined for --enable-kernel=4.18.0 and higher.
- Use ifdef __ASSUME_RSEQ rather than ifdef __NR_rseq to discover rseq
  availability. This is necessary now that the system call numbers are
  integrated within glibc.
It's not quite clear to me why you need __ASSUME_RSEQ.

Can you use __has_include in <sys/rseq.h>, with a copy of the kernel
definitions if the kernel header is not available?
